    From a CBR 250 to 848/1098/1098S wise move?

    Hey Stewy,

    If it's not to late I'd like to throw in the 1098 Dry clutch factor, it's a bitch to street ride with. Don't get me wrong I love the look of the open cover, the noise and the way I can just hammer it up to speed, but around town it lurches, grabs and is like a hair trigger. Also the gearing is really high, so the bike lurches something fierce below 50 km/h, although I bet a different sprocket would cure most of that. It's not bad for me because most of my riding is at retard speeds on deserted backroads and I only have to suffer the few lights coming into town to gloat at the coffee shop usually. Just something to consider.
